diff options
author | Spike Sprague <spikuru@google.com> | 2014-09-19 11:18:46 -0700 |
---|---|---|
committer | The Android Automerger <android-build@google.com> | 2014-09-19 11:56:00 -0700 |
commit | a0697c5b879f48ad009192028b34578eae42f394 (patch) | |
tree | 7a0c105dd8a3e4b337e7205a13c8c1171f3703ce | |
parent | bdba0dc07cc6a0a0ba08aeb5903b7b00b6cfc1ef (diff) | |
download | android_packages_apps_Camera2-a0697c5b879f48ad009192028b34578eae42f394.tar.gz android_packages_apps_Camera2-a0697c5b879f48ad009192028b34578eae42f394.tar.bz2 android_packages_apps_Camera2-a0697c5b879f48ad009192028b34578eae42f394.zip |
add null check to updateCameraParametersPreferences to apease the monkey
bug: 17580046
Change-Id: I4a109c1134684f6d5b2dafdb138137ef36f208f0
-rw-r--r-- | src/com/android/camera/PhotoModule.java |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/src/com/android/camera/PhotoModule.java b/src/com/android/camera/PhotoModule.java index ffa5601c8..ab6afdb2a 100644 --- a/src/com/android/camera/PhotoModule.java +++ b/src/com/android/camera/PhotoModule.java @@ -2110,6 +2110,12 @@ public class PhotoModule } private void updateCameraParametersPreference() { + // some monkey tests can get here when shutting the app down + // make sure mCameraDevice is still valid, b/17580046 + if (mCameraDevice == null) { + return; + } + setAutoExposureLockIfSupported(); setAutoWhiteBalanceLockIfSupported(); setFocusAreasIfSupported(); |